2008 August > The Mitsubishi City Chase Series

City Chase is a unique urban adventure that requires teams of two to exhibit teamwork, resourcefulness, determination and the ability to make decisions on the fly as they search for physical, intellectual and adventurous ChasePoint challenges scattered in unknown locations throughout the city of Ottawa. Focusing more on the journey than the destination, participants learned about their city, their teammate, and themselves as they enjoyed a full day of laughter, adventure and discovery through an original urban race experience!!
